Substitute Ayoub Sorensen scored a last-minute equaliser as Lyngby earned a 2-2 SAS-Liga draw at Silkeborg.

The hosts led 2-0 after goals from Rajko Lekic (34) and Jesper Bech (67). But Kim Aabech pulled a goal back with 18 minutes remaining and Sorensen was introduced shortly afterwards, making the crucial impact in stoppage time.

Nordsjaelland eased to a second win in their first three games as Nicolai Stokholm's first-half brace (10, 45) earned them a 2-0 success at Randers. Jens Stryger Larsen scored the only goal in the 32nd minute as Brondby inflicted Midtjylland's first defeat of the fledgling season.
